About Dalhousie University Dalhousie University is Atlantic Canada’s leading research-intensive university and a driver of the region’s intellectual, social and economic development. Located in the heart of Halifax, Nova Scotia, with an Agricultural Campus in Truro/Bible Hill, Dalhousie is a truly national and international university, with more than half of our almost 21,000 students coming from outside of the province. Our 6,000 faculty and staff foster a vibrant, purpose-driven community, that celebrated 200 years of academic excellence in 2018. Job Summary Under the direction of the Associate Director, Academic Regulations, the Assistant Registrar, Registration and Degree Audit is responsible for jointly managing the degree audit process for the University, including encoding requirements in the degree audit client, evaluating student records relative to degree requirements, and coordinating registration set-up and training. The Assistant Registrar, Registration and Degree Audit develops and delivers training on reading and interacting with Degree Audit functions for students, advisors, departments, and faculties, for the Registrar’s Office, and broader university community. Advising (both holding dedicated student advising as well as instructor, departmental, faculty advising) is a core component of this role. The incumbent manages one full time staff that develop and build the academic timetables and formal examination schedules for all Dalhousie programs. Key Responsibilities Manages the Degree Audit Reporting System, a complex software package that allows encoding of an institution’s degree rules and requirements. Plan, organize and co-ordinate registration procedures for all Dalhousie faculties. This requires liaison, negotiation and problem solving with faculty, administrators and staff of academic and administrative units across the university to ensure a smooth process is established. The Degree Audit Reporting System is available to faculty advisors, Student Services advisors, and students via the web. The incumbent is the provider of user support and training. Regular, ongoing advising sessions should be available to students. Generates degree audit batches for Faculties and Departments in support of Graduation eligibility assessments. Responsible for the daily management of 1 full time staff member.
